您当前的位置: 首页 > 学无止境 > 心得笔记 网站首页心得笔记
mongodb-mongo库表操作语句
发布时间:2017-11-22 19:06:42编辑:雪饮阅读()
查看mongodb中目前所有数据库
show databases;或show dbs
默认有admin,local,test这三个数据库,admin和local两个库轻易不要动
选库命令如:use test
显示当前库下面所拥有的表
show tables或show collections
每个库中的system前缀的表也不要轻易动
创建表
如创建一个user表
db.createCollection(‘user’);
如何创建库(隐式创建库)
mongodb的库是隐式创建,你可以use一个不存在的库,然后在该库下创建collection即可创建库
插入记录
如
db.user.insert({name:'xy',age:25});
查询记录
如
db.user.find()
会发现查询出的记录比你添加时候多了一个_id字段
这个_id字段如果你在新增时也有该字段,则你的_id值会替换他这里自动增加的_id字段的值。
隐式创建表
如
db.woShiBuCunZaiDeBiao.insert({name:'test'})
这是在插入记录时如果该表不存在则隐式创建。
删除表
如
db.woShiBuCunZaiDeBiao.drop()
删除数据库
db.dropDatabase()
这是删除当前所在use下的库。
关键字词:mongodb,修改数据库,修改表
上一篇:mongodb-手动预先分片